The most common signs include mud tubes along your foundation walls, discarded wings near windows and doors (especially during spring swarming season), and hollow-sounding wood when you tap on it. You might also notice small holes in wood with tiny pellets nearby, which indicates drywood termites.
However, the tricky thing about termites is that they often cause significant damage before you see obvious signs. Subterranean termites, the most common type in Eldred, do most of their damage inside wood structures where you can’t see it happening.
That’s why regular professional inspections are so important. Our trained technicians can spot early warning signs that homeowners typically miss, potentially saving you thousands in damage that would occur if the infestation went undetected.
In Eldred, termite swarming season typically runs from January through May, with peak activity in spring months. However, Florida’s warm climate means termites are actually active year-round—swarming season is just when you’re most likely to see the winged reproductive termites that indicate established colonies nearby.
Subterranean termites often swarm at night after rain, while drywood termites tend to swarm during the day in late spring and early summer. If you see swarmers around your property, it’s a strong indicator that there’s an established colony within 150 feet of your home.

Liquid termiticide treatments typically provide protection for 5-7 years when applied correctly, though annual inspections are recommended to ensure the barrier remains intact. Bait station systems require ongoing monitoring and bait replacement but can provide continuous protection for decades with proper maintenance.
Florida’s climate and soil conditions can affect treatment longevity. Heavy rains, construction activity, and landscaping changes can compromise chemical barriers, which is why regular professional inspections are crucial for maintaining protection.
